Ive been SO very tempted to do like a local guy and do a custom side by side setup with a Honda Civic radiator and a narrow (width) 4'' thick IC core with short pipes. Im sure it wouldnt turn out as nice as his since my welding skills arent up to par, but it would probably work nicely. Any reason more people dont do the side by side thing? He said he didnt notice any reduction in cooling, though I dont know if he tracks it or anything. Even though its a smaller rad, its not blocked at all by the IC. This way would make for very clean and short piping also.

Under most circumstances the side by side yields the same amount of direct exposure that "sandwich" with a full rad behind does. IMO the best approach is to use a double pass rad so that you're getting that same unit of coolant into direct airflow once, and then again from post IC air.
